What makes a protein powder good? Its biological value, and this is the essence of it all. I will try to explain it very clearly. Biological value shows what percentage of the digested protein is incorporated into the body, meaning whether the amino acid composition of the consumed protein is most suitable for muscle cells to be built from it. The biological value (BV). For quality products, this number is around 85-90%. Now come the tricks. Some manufacturers achieve a more pleasant taste by mixing sugar and extra carbohydrates into protein powders, which is one of the biggest rip-offs against you, because by pouring these carbohydrates into yourself, you won't be able to lose weight, let alone get in shape, even with the strictest diet. This is the primary point of why some protein is crap. Then... It's good to be aware of a few things. It really matters where, how, and according to what quality production standards your protein is made. There are three globally recognized quality systems; look for their names on the packaging: HACCP, GMP, ISO.
